Abstract

The invention discloses a head end device of a cable tackle. The head end device of the cable tackle comprises two supporting plates, a bracket connected with the two supporting plates, a pair of side plates fixed on the bracket, a pair of tapered rollers mounted on the pair of side plates, two supporting frames fixed on two sides of the pair of side plates and two pairs of side guide wheels, wherein each pair of side guide wheels is arranged on the corresponding supporting frame; the axes of the side guide wheels are perpendicular to the axes of the tapered rollers, an end extending plate is arranged on the bracket, and a connecting hole is formed in the end extending plate; a cushioning and aligning mechanism connected with each pair of side guide wheels is arranged on each supporting frame; a locking mechanism is arranged in the connecting hole; guide rail cleaning mechanisms are arranged on the tapered rollers. The head end device of the cable tackle is simple in structure, convenient to produce and low in cost and does not get stuck easily.

Technical field
The present invention relates to logistics equipment technical field, relate to a kind of double bracket plate cable coaster for hoisting crane in particular.
Background technology
Existing cable coaster it be made up of travelling wheel, support, supporting plate etc., flexible cable is fixed on supporting plate, synchronous with cable coaster by drawbar frame, thus realize dolly and to power object.
Number of patent application is CN201310557428.1, the applying date is a kind of Head end of cable pulley of Chinese invention patent of 2013.11.12, comprise the supporting plate for load-bearing cable, with the support that described supporting plate is connected, fixing pair of side plates on the bracket, be arranged on a pair taper running roller in described pair of side plates, two pairs of supports and two couple be fixed on described two pairs of supports of being fixed on described pair of side plates both sides are directed laterally to wheel, described be directed laterally to wheel axis and described tapered roller wheel axis perpendicular, the limit shaft be positioned at below described a pair taper running roller is installed between described pair of side plates, described limit shaft is provided with guide pulley, the length of described guide pulley is 0.85-0.9 times of the spacing of described pair of side plates.
But fault rate is higher in the course of the work for present cable trailing head end, and work efficiency is low.

Buffering aligning guide 7 cushions for being directed laterally to wheel 5 to a pair, ensure that two positions being directed laterally to wheel can be aimed at, realize two be directed laterally to wheel slide smoothly on I-beam section guide rail, because in real work, the present wheel 5 that is directed laterally to for a pair is all rigidly fixed on bracing frame 4, this is fixing with regard to causing the distance be directed laterally to for a pair between wheel, processing, assembly precision requires all higher, and, once there is mis-aligned in real work, one is made to be directed laterally to wheel and I-beam section guide rail contact, and another volume be directed laterally to wheel do not contact with I-beam section guide rail, the work of whole cable trailing will be affected, cause the deflection of track adjusting wheel, clamping stagnation, affect its work efficiency, and cushion aligning guide and solve this problem, reduce installation and working accuracy, can the be real-time position being directed laterally to wheel for a pair be adjusted, ensure that often pair is directed laterally to wheel and all contacts with I-beam section guide rail actv., described buffering aligning guide 7 comprises the horizontal sliding cavity 701 of a pair of being located on support frame as described above 4, the horizontal sliding shoe 703 be located in described horizontal sliding cavity 701, the elastic body 705 that is located at the UNICOM chamber 704 described in a pair between horizontal sliding cavity 701 and is located in described UNICOM chamber 704, the cross-sectional plane of horizontal sliding shoe 703, horizontal sliding cavity 701 is rectangle or positive six distortion.Described elastic body 705 comprises two end elastic bodys and the intermediate elastomeric between two end elastic bodys, and two end elastic bodys respectively with two horizontal sliding shoes 703 contact.

Described catch gear 8 can be locked to the connection cord etc. being arranged in connecting bore, prevent it from loosening or rocking, ensure the stability connected, catch gear 8 comprise the slip clamp 801 be located in described connecting bore 202, adjustment block 804 that the clamp dip plane 802 be located on described slip clamp 801, the adjustment screw 803 be screwed onto on described extension board 201 are connected with described adjustment screw 803 and be located in described adjustment block 804 and the adjustment dip plane 805 fitted in described clamp dip plane 802; Extension board is provided with the mounting groove for mounting and adjusting block, and mounting groove and connecting bore communicate, and mounting groove is vertically arranged; Described adjustment block 804 is provided with ring cavity 806, and the coupling link 807 be fixedly connected with described adjustment screw 803 is positioned at described ring cavity 806.Slide in connecting bore for the ease of slip clamp, the upper/lower terminal of slip clamp is provided with extension slide block, and connecting bore is provided with and extends the extension chute that slide block coordinates.
Described guide rail cleaning mechanism 9 comprises the multiple mounting holes 901 be located on described taper running roller 6 outer circumference surface, be located at and knock block 902 in each described mounting hole 901, the arc surface 903 of block 901 lower end is knocked described in being located at, with the described elastic connection plate 904 knocking block 902 and be fixedly connected with, be located at the elastic component 905 between described elastic connection plate 904 and described mounting hole 901 bottom surface and be located in described mounting hole 901 for limiting the snap ring 906 of described elastic connection plate 904, knock block 902 for cylinder, the end face of its lower end is arc surface, arc surface is provided with decorative pattern, the bottom surface of mounting hole 901 is provided with the bottom outlet that diameter is less than mounting hole, and bottom outlet is used for installing resilient snubber 908, elastic component 905 is Compress Spring, and elastic connection plate 904, snap ring 906 are made up of spring plate.
